- FAS/SEL: Per rules will be a minimum of 83% clear. However, our imported hardwoods are close to being all clear. Widths will be 6" and wider allowing a small percentage of 4" and 5". Lengths are 8' and longer.
- FAS/SEL 6' and 7' only: Widths are 6" and wider allowing a small percentage of 4" and 5".
- 1 & 2 Common: Our common grade is mainly due to some wave or twist and some checks. Ideal for small cuttings. Widths are 4" and wider, heavy 6" and wider. Lengths are 6' and longer, heavy 8' and longer.
- 1 Common only: Per rules 2/3rds clear with specified cutting. Main defects are knots, 4" and wider, heavy 6" and wider. 6' and longer.
